Understanding the Mechanics of the Crash Game

At its heart, a crash game operates on a simple concept: a multiplier starts at 1x and steadily increases over time. Players place a bet at the beginning of each round, and the goal is to cash out before the multiplier ‘crashes’ – meaning it reaches a random point and the round ends, resulting in a loss of the bet. The longer you wait to cash out, the higher the multiplier and the larger your potential payout. However, the crash can occur at any moment, making timing crucial. This core loop fosters a sense of anticipation and excitement, distinguishing it from many other casino offerings. The random number generator (RNG) that determines when the crash will occur is a crucial component and needs to be certified as fair and unbiased by independent auditing bodies.

The interface of a typical crash game is straightforward. Players usually see a graph depicting the increasing multiplier, a bet panel where they can adjust their stake, and a 'Cash Out' button. Some games offer features like ‘Auto Cash Out,’ which allows players to pre-set a multiplier at which their bet will automatically be cashed out, removing some of the pressure of manual timing. The visual representation of the escalating multiplier is designed to be engaging and visually stimulating, adding to the overall immersive experience. It's also common to find 'live' crash games where rounds happen quickly and continuously, mimicking the pace of a traditional casino floor.

The Role of the Random Number Generator (RNG)

The integrity of any crash game hinges on the fairness of its random number generator. A properly functioning RNG ensures that the crash point is truly random and unbiased, giving all players an equal chance of winning. Reputable crash game providers employ provably fair systems, which allow players to verify the randomness of each game round. These systems utilize cryptographic algorithms and seed values to ensure transparency and build trust. Players can often access information about the seed values and hashing algorithms used in a particular game, enabling them to independently confirm the fairness of the results. A lack of transparency regarding the RNG should be a red flag for any potential player.

Beyond the core randomness, the distribution of crash points should be statistically consistent over a large number of rounds. Game providers should make this statistical data available to demonstrate the fairness of the game. Regular audits by independent testing agencies are also essential to ensure that the RNG continues to operate correctly and without manipulation. These audits add an extra layer of security and reassurance for players.

Strategic Approaches to Playing Crash Games

While the crash game is fundamentally a game of chance, certain strategies can help players manage their risk and potentially increase their chances of winning. One common approach is the Martingale strategy, where players double their bet after each loss, aiming to recover their previous losses with a single win. However, this strategy requires a substantial bankroll and can quickly lead to significant losses if a losing streak persists. Another strategy is to set a target multiplier and cash out as soon as that multiplier is reached, regardless of the current game round. This helps players avoid greed and prevent potential losses. Understanding your risk tolerance and adapting your strategy accordingly is vital for responsible gameplay.

Beyond simply choosing a bet size and target multiplier, advanced players often incorporate statistical analysis and pattern recognition into their gameplay. While past results do not guarantee future outcomes, observing trends in crash points can provide insights into the game's behavior. Some players utilize software tools to track historical data and identify potential patterns. However, it’s crucial to remember that the RNG is designed to be unpredictable, and relying solely on historical data can be misleading. The skill lies in carefully balancing statistical observation with an understanding of the inherent randomness of the game.

Risk Management and Bankroll Control

Effective risk management is paramount when playing this type of casino game. Never bet more than you can afford to lose, and always set a budget before you start playing. Dividing your bankroll into smaller units and betting only a small percentage of your bankroll on each round can help you withstand losing streaks. Consider using the auto cash out feature to lock in profits and prevent impulsive decisions. Avoid chasing losses by increasing your bet size after a loss; this can quickly deplete your bankroll. The key is to play responsibly and treat the game as a form of entertainment, rather than a guaranteed source of income.

Developing a clear exit strategy is also crucial. Decide in advance when you will stop playing, whether it’s after reaching a certain profit target or after losing a predetermined amount. Sticking to your exit strategy will help you avoid emotional decision-making and protect your bankroll. Remember that the house always has an edge, and it's important to approach the game with realistic expectations.
